Settings for throughfeed machining (conv_sync.*)
Through feed machines are essentially used for fast consecutive machining of workpieces. These are firmly secured on a conveyor belt and pass through several successive machining stations. The conveyor belt runs at a constant speed, i.e. workpieces are machined without stopping while they pass through the stations. The conveyor belt therefore represents an axis with a constant feed rate.

The machining stations (units) may possess an X axis in parallel with the belt's direction of motion and a feed axis Y perpendicular to it. Below, the belt axis is referred to as the master axis. For stable synchronisation, it is generally necessary to smooth the actual values of the master axis. This is achieved by means of the filter parameters described below
